实现PHP商城商品配送时效计算

php开发商城中的商品配送时效计算功能实现步骤

随着电子商务的快速发展,越来越多的消费者选择在网上购物。在购物过程中,商品的配送时效成为消费者选择购买的重要因素之一。在PHP开发的商城系统中,实现商品配送时效计算功能可以提高用户体验,同时也更好地满足消费者的需求。本文将介绍具体的实现步骤。

一、数据准备
在开始实现商品配送时效计算功能之前,我们需要准备一些相关的数据:

运输公司的配送区域和时效数据;商品的发货地址及其对应的配送区域。

二、创建数据库表
在数据库中创建两个表,分别用于存储运输公司的配送区域和时效数据以及商品的发货地址。

三、编写代码实现

立即学习“PHP免费学习笔记(深入)”;

连接数据库
使用PHP代码连接到数据库,并选择要使用的数据库。查询运输公司的配送区域和时效数据
使用SQL查询语句获取运输公司的配送区域和时效数据,将其保存到一个数组中。查询商品的发货地址
根据用户选择的商品,查询其发货地址,并根据地址匹配运输公司的配送区域。计算配送时效
将用户选择的商品和对应的发货地址的配送区域与运输公司的配送区域进行匹配,获取对应的配送时效数据。显示配送时效
将计算出的配送时效数据显示给用户。

四、优化实现效率
为了提高程序的运行效率,我们可以将运输公司的配送区域和时效数据存储在缓存中。可以使用Redis、Memcached等内存缓存技术。

五、测试功能
完成代码编写后,进行功能测试。可以模拟不同的商品和发货地址进行测试,确保计算配送时效功能正常运行。

六、优化用户体验
为了提升用户体验,可以在前端界面上展示商品配送时效的相关信息,例如显示快递公司名称、配送区域和预计送达时间等。

总结:
通过以上步骤,我们可以在PHP开发的商城系统中实现商品配送时效计算功能。这样的功能实现不仅提升了用户体验,还能够更好地满足消费者对商品配送时效的需求。同时,通过优化实现效率和提升用户体验,商城系统也能够提升自身的竞争力。

以上就是实现PHP商城商品配送时效计算的详细内容,更多请关注【创想鸟】其它相关文章!

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至253000106@qq.com举报,一经查实,本站将立刻删除。

发布者:PHP中文网,转转请注明出处:https://www.chuangxiangniao.com/p/1957298.html

(0)
上一篇 2025年2月23日 04:09:20
下一篇 2025年2月23日 04:09:35

AD推荐 黄金广告位招租... 更多推荐

相关推荐

  • ThinkPHP开发注意事项:合理使用路由规则

    ThinkPHP是一款基于MVC模式的开源PHP框架,它提供了很多便捷的功能和丰富的文档,使开发变得更加高效和便捷。在使用ThinkPHP进行开发时,路由规则是一个非常重要的部分。本文将介绍ThinkPHP的路由规则,并提出一些注意事项,以…

    2025年3月13日
    200
  • 如何使用Laravel开发一个在线旅游平台

    如何使用Laravel开发一个在线旅游平台 在旅游行业快速发展的当今,越来越多的人选择在网上预订旅游产品和服务。为了满足这一需求,开发一个高效、可靠的在线旅游平台变得至关重要。Laravel作为一款流行的PHP框架,提供了丰富的功能和便捷的…

    2025年3月13日
    200
  • 利用Laravel success方法提升开发效率

    标题:利用Laravel Success 方法提升开发效率 在Laravel开发中,成功地处理用户请求并返回相关信息是非常重要的一项任务。为了简化这一过程并提高开发效率,Laravel 提供了 success 方法。本文将探讨如何利用 su…

    2025年3月13日
    200
  • 如何使用uniapp开发身份证识别功能

    如何使用uniapp开发身份证识别功能 引言:身份证识别是移动应用领域中一项非常重要的功能,它可以在用户拍摄身份证照片后,自动解析出身份证上的信息。本文将介绍如何使用uniapp开发身份证识别功能,并附上代码示例,帮助开发者快速实现这一功能…

    编程技术 2025年3月13日
    200
  • 如何使用uniapp开发倒计时功能

    如何使用uniapp开发倒计时功能 一、引言倒计时是许多应用程序中常见的功能之一,它可以用于各种场景,例如活动倒计时、秒杀倒计时等。在uniapp中,我们可以通过使用Vue的计时器和uniapp提供的组件来实现这个功能。本文将介绍如何使用u…

    编程技术 2025年3月13日
    200
  • 如何使用uniapp开发滚动加载功能

    如何使用uniapp开发滚动加载功能 滚动加载是一种常见的Web开发功能,它可以在用户滚动页面时动态加载更多的数据,以实现无限滚动的效果。在uniapp中,我们可以使用一些技术和方法来实现滚动加载功能。 布局页面 首先,我们需要在uniap…

    编程技术 2025年3月13日
    200
  • 如何使用uniapp开发扫码支付功能

    如何使用uniapp开发扫码支付功能 随着移动支付的普及,扫码支付已经成为人们生活中不可或缺的一部分。对于开发者而言,使用uniapp进行扫码支付功能的开发是一个很实用的技术。本文将介绍如何使用uniapp开发扫码支付功能,并提供代码示例。…

    编程技术 2025年3月13日
    200
  • 如何使用uniapp开发语音识别功能

    如何使用uniapp开发语音识别功能 语音技术的普及和应用越来越广泛,语音识别已成为许多应用程序的重要功能之一。在uniapp框架中,我们可以利用uniapp提供的跨平台能力,快速开发出具备语音识别功能的应用。本文将介绍如何使用uniapp…

    编程技术 2025年3月13日
    200
  • 如何使用uniapp开发多级菜单功能

    如何使用uniapp开发多级菜单功能 在移动应用开发中,常常需要使用多级菜单来实现更复杂的功能和交互体验。而uniapp作为一款跨平台开发框架,可以帮助开发者快速实现多级菜单的功能。本文将详细介绍如何使用uniapp开发多级菜单功能,并附上…

    编程技术 2025年3月13日
    200
  • 如何使用uniapp开发图片放大镜功能

    如何使用uniapp开发图片放大镜功能 引言:在现代社交媒体与电子商务的时代,图片放大镜功能成为了一个非常重要的功能,能够提升用户的体验和购物体验。在uniapp中,我们可以使用相应的组件和API来实现图片放大镜功能。本文将介绍如何使用un…

    编程技术 2025年3月13日
    200

发表回复

登录后才能评论